Specialist Roof Contractors: The Key to a Lasting Roof Involving professional roof specialists is pivotal, as their specialized abilities and expertise can substantially affect the high quality of installment and the durability of products made use of. What aspects should one consider to guarantee that the investment in roof covering https://roof-replacement-companie86306.blog-kids.com/31595874/affordable-residential-roofing-solutions-that-last